Visitors to top Rocky Mountain resorts have a new way of renting a vacation home thanks to an innovative new web site called VacationRentalsByAuction.com.  This unique new service lets visitors bid on available dates on up to 1,000 privately owned vacation homes -- many of which still have open dates for this ski season. This site was created by Resortia LLC - the largest independent vacation rental agency in the Rockies.

mt-rental-vaca.jpgThe user-friendly site allows visitors to bid on specific time periods for privately owned vacation homes in 10 of the most popular resort communities - including Vail, Aspen, Breckenridge, Steamboat Springs and Park City.  "The Vacation Rentals By Auction service takes some of the top features of proven Internet auction leaders, and popular rental advertising portals, and melds them into a satisfying vacation lodging experience at a great value," according to Resortia's CEO Larry Hoffer.  

"We've built on Southwest Airlines' successful model and eliminated any hidden booking and housekeeping fees.  Our quoted rates are all inclusive, predictable, and guaranteed.  They even include lodging taxes -- so visitors know exactly what their costs will be.  Plus we certify that all of the homes are exactly as promised, because one of our representatives personally visits each home to ensure that the pictures and information used to describe a residence are accurate," he says.

Opening minimum bids generally start at about a 40 percent discount, with some discounts exceeding 50 percent. All auctions are "No Reserve" -- meaning that visitors will win the auction regardless of how low the winning bid is.  Plus all auctions have a "Rent-it-Now" option allowing visitors to immediately secure the home for the time period being auctioned.

Resortia was founded in 2003 to develop profitable innovative business solutions that enhance the lives of visitors and homeowners in premier destination communities. Resortia currently operates rental agency businesses in Vail, Beaver Creek, Aspen, Snowmass, Steamboat, Breckenridge, Winter Park and Telluride in Colorado, Park City and Deer Valley in Utah and in Jackson Hole, Wyoming.  (www.VacationRentalsByAuction.com and www.resortia.com)

13 teams attending the 20th Annual International Snow Sculpture Championships

Experience the visual wonderment of the creation and exhibition of snow art. The Budweiser International Snow Sculpture Championships return to Breckenridge for the 20th year from January 26-31, 2010.

snow-sculp.jpg

Thirteen teams from around the globe have been invited to compete from seven countries including Canada (two teams), China, Czech Republic, Lithuania, Mexico, Russia and the USA. The United States teams invited include Alaska, Colorado (Breckenridge and Loveland), Idaho, Minnesota and Wisconsin. Snow Sculpting is attended annually by more than 30,000 people of all ages from across the USA and the world.

Each year, four-person teams are assigned 12-foot-tall, 20-ton blocks of machine-made Colorado snow. These teams work within a five-day period to create their sculptures. From these blocks of snow, the teams often craft enormous pieces of whimsy, although some deliver powerful political or social commentary.

The finished pieces are achieved after a total of 65 intense hours of work without the use of power tools, internal support structures or colorants - just the ingenuity of the sculptors and a medium that lends itself, if only temporarily, to the persuasion of hand tools.

When the sculptures are finished on Saturday, January 30, a panel of well-known artists and patrons of the arts serve as judges. Awards are presented to the first, second and third place sculptures on Sunday, January 31. Awards are also given for People's Choice, Kids' Choice and Artists' Choice. There are no cash prizes; the artists instead revel in the reward of hard work, forged friendships, freedom of artistic expression and the satisfaction of long hours of preparation that lead to the event.

No one would have guessed 20 years ago that the first International Snow Sculpture Championships in Breckenridge would have grown into the renowned world-class event it is today, and that the founders of the event would still be passionately sculpting for Team Breckenridge 20 years later.
